Abstract

The utility model discloses a stable photographing support, which comprises a main body rod and a mobile phone support, wherein the mobile phone support is positioned at the top end of the main body rod, the top of the main body rod is fixedly connected with a mounting cylinder, the top of the mounting cylinder is rotatably connected with a bearing seat, the mobile phone support is arranged on the bearing seat, and the inner wall of the mounting cylinder is connected with a movable plate in a sliding manner. According to the utility model, the limit of the mobile phone support can be realized rapidly through the cooperation of the toothed ring and the gear, the bearing seat can be directly rotated to change the photographing direction in the photographing or live broadcasting process, the whole photographing support is not required to be rotated, the labor amount required to be input by personnel is reduced, the follow-up readjustment of the photographing support is prevented, meanwhile, the bottom end supporting point position is changed through arranging the movable extension rods on the plurality of groups of auxiliary supporting legs, the contact area with the ground can be increased through the cooperation of the stabilizing plate capable of being automatically attached, and the photographing support can be kept stable even on the inclined ground.

Technical Field
The utility model relates to the technical field of photographic supports, in particular to a stable photographic support.
Background
The photographic support is used for supporting the photographic mobile phone, the mobile phone is clamped on the mobile phone support of the photographic support, the mobile phone is fixed, the support rod at the bottom of the photographic support is unfolded, and the photographic support can be stably supported on the ground for use.

In the use process of the equipment, the supporting legs are required to be unfolded and then connected through the mobile phone, if the shooting direction is not suitable after the mobile phone is connected, the whole shooting support is required to be adjusted, the equipment is inconvenient, meanwhile, the supporting legs are only provided with bottom supporting points to be contacted with the ground, the stability is not connected, and meanwhile, if the ground is not flat enough, the shooting support is inclined and is not stable enough.

When the photographing live broadcast is required to be carried out by using a mobile phone, a user adjusts the main body rod 1 to a proper height, then the user lifts the main body rod 1 and pulls the auxiliary mechanism 10 to the side, the multiple groups of auxiliary mechanisms 10 synchronously move to the side, then the user releases the main body rod 1 to be acted by gravity, the multiple groups of auxiliary mechanisms 10 form an inclined angle state with the main body rod 1, the multiple groups of stabilizing plates 1004 are stably attached to the ground, even if the inclined angle of the inclined hinged stabilizing plates 1004 on the ground is formed, the friction with the ground is increased, the stability of the photographing support is improved, then the user clamps and connects the mobile phone by the mobile phone support 2, during debugging or photographing, the user downwards presses the operating rod 7, the operating rod 7 and the gear 9 synchronously move downwards, the spring 6 atress shrink and produce opposite effort to make ring gear 8 lose restriction, the user rotates and bears seat 4 and can change cell phone stand 2 and cell-phone photographic direction, need not to adjust photographic support, loosen action bars 7 after adjusting, spring 6 promotes fly leaf 5 and moves up, the meshing that is comparatively dense tooth can be realized, if be in the outdoor live broadcast that shoots, the topography is uneven enough, the user can be with multiunit auxiliary mechanism 10 after expanding rotate the screw sleeve 1002 on the corresponding auxiliary mechanism 10, the extension rod 1003 with screw sleeve 1002 threaded connection begins to remove in synchronizing shaft 1001 inside, thereby the height position of stabilizer 1004 has been changed, and stabilizer 1004 can rotate better laminating with ground of direction, and then make body pole 1 keep vertical state, keep stable.
According to the utility model, the limit of the mobile phone support 2 can be realized rapidly through the cooperation of the toothed ring 8 and the gear 9, the shooting direction can be changed by directly rotating the bearing seat 4 in the shooting or direct seeding process, the whole rotation of the shooting support is not needed, the labor amount required to be input by personnel is reduced, the subsequent readjustment of the shooting support is prevented, meanwhile, the bottom end pivot position is changed through arranging the movable extension rods 1003 on a plurality of groups of auxiliary support legs, the contact area with the ground can be increased through cooperation of the automatic laminating stabilizing plate 1004, and the shooting support can be kept stable even on the inclined ground.
Please refer to fig. 4, wherein: the bottom end of the stabilizing plate 1004 is fixedly connected with evenly distributed lugs 11, and the lugs 11 are made of rubber materials.
In the present utility model, the bump 11 made of rubber is deformed by gravity when the stabilizer 1004 is attached to the ground, thereby further improving the stability of friction enhancement.
Please refer to fig. 3, wherein: a limiting rod 12 is fixedly connected to the inner top wall of the synchronous shaft 1001, a limiting groove 13 is formed in the top end of the extension rod 1003, and the limiting rod 12 is located in the limiting groove 13 and is in sliding connection with the inner wall of the limiting groove 13.
In the utility model, the cooperation of the limiting rod 12 and the limiting groove 13 can limit the extension rod 1003, so that the extension rod 1003 is always positioned in the synchronous shaft 1001 to keep stable movement.
Please refer to fig. 1 and 3, wherein: the outer ring of the thread bush 1002 is fixedly connected with a soft pad, and the soft pad is made of rubber materials.
According to the utility model, the rubber soft pad can increase the hand friction of a user, prevent the hand from sliding, and improve the hand comfort of the user.
Please refer to fig. 2, wherein: the inside of the spring 6 is provided with a guide rod 14, the bottom end of the guide rod 14 is fixedly connected to the inner bottom wall of the mounting cylinder 3, and the top end of the guide rod 14 penetrates and extends to the top of the movable plate 5.
In the utility model, the guide rod 14 can limit the movable plate 5, so that the movable plate 5 always keeps stable movement in the vertical direction.
